According to a report by The Straits Times, four investors devised plans to circumvent the Additional Buyer’s Stamp Duty (ABSD) by nominating third parties to hold property titles for them. This arrangement allowed the investors to pay lower taxes, as the nominees were treated as the legal buyers. However, the scheme was uncovered by Singapore’s tax authorities, resulting in the forfeiture of the properties. The report did not disclose specific names or property values but noted that the investors lost their entire holdings due to the violation. ABSD is a key cooling measure introduced by the Singapore government to moderate property demand and curb speculative investment. Using nominees or other indirect holding structures to avoid ABSD is illegal and can lead to severe penalties, including seizure of the property and potential prosecution. This case underscores the strict enforcement of tax regulations in Singapore’s real estate market.

The Inland Revenue Authority of Singapore (IRAS) has been actively scrutinizing such schemes, and the consequences for non-compliance may be significant, including loss of property, additional tax payments, and legal action. For investors, this serves as a cautionary example: any attempt to evade ABSD through nominee arrangements or other artificial structures could lead to total financial loss. The market perspective suggests that such enforcement actions may deter potential violators, reinforcing the credibility of Singapore’s property cooling policies. It also emphasizes the importance of transparent and legal tax planning when acquiring residential properties.

From an investment standpoint, this case may prompt property buyers to reassess their approach to tax compliance. While ABSD rates are high for foreign buyers and those purchasing multiple properties, the potential penalties for evasion could outweigh any short-term tax savings. Broader implications for the Singapore property market include continued government vigilance against speculative practices, which may help maintain market stability. Investors are advised to seek professional advice on legitimate tax structures and ensure full compliance with all regulations. The episode also reflects the government’s commitment to fair taxation and housing affordability. Ultimately, legal and transparent investment strategies are likely to be the most sustainable path for property investors in Singapore.
